如何制作属于自己的ai智能体

AI大学堂 2025-08-03
```html 如何制作属于自己的AI智能体

一、理解基础概念

要制作一个AI智能体,首先需要对人工智能的基本原理有深入理解。这包括机器学习(Machine Learning)、深度学习(Deep Learning)和自然语言处理(Natural Language Processing)等核心领域。掌握这些知识,可以从选择合适的编程语言(如Python)和库(如TensorFlow或PyTorch)开始。

了解神经网络的工作机制,特别是前馈神经网络(Feedforward Neural Networks)和循环神经网络(Recurrent Neural Networks),是构建智能体的基础。同时,理解强化学习(Reinforcement Learning)的概念,让你的AI能够通过与环境互动来学习和优化策略。

二、设计项目框架

设计阶段是关键,你需要明确你的AI智能体的目标。这可能是图像识别、语音识别、聊天机器人或者游戏策略。确定任务后,设计项目的架构,包括输入数据处理、模型训练和输出结果分析部分。

使用模块化的方法,将项目分解为几个可管理的部分,如数据预处理、模型训练、评估指标和优化算法。确保每个部分都有清晰的功能定义和接口设计。

选择适合任务的训练数据集,并对其进行预处理,以便于模型学习。例如,对于图像识别,可能需要对图片进行归一化和缩放。

三、实现与训练

在编程环境中,如Jupyter Notebook或VS Code,开始编写代码。首先,建立并初始化你的神经网络模型,然后加载数据并开始训练。

使用适当的优化算法(如Adam或SGD)调整模型参数,通过反向传播算法更新权重,以最小化损失函数。训练过程中,定期保存模型,以便于后续的迭代或迁移学习。

在训练完成后,进行模型验证和测试,确保它在未见过的数据上表现良好。如果需要,可以通过调整超参数或使用更复杂的模型结构来提升性能。

结语

制作一个AI智能体是一个既富有挑战又充满乐趣的过程。持续学习和实践是提升技能的关键。随着技术的发展,新的工具和框架不断涌现,保持对最新动态的关注,你将能够创建出越来越强大的AI智能体。

```
©️版权声明:本站所有资源均收集于网络,只做学习和交流使用,版权归原作者所有。若您需要使用非免费的软件或服务,请购买正版授权并合法使用。本站发布的内容若侵犯到您的权益,请联系站长删除,我们将及时处理。

相关文章